Blood Sugar Impact of Peanut Butter Crispy Bar, Peanut Butter
Peanut Butter Crispy Bar, Peanut Butter has a BSI score of 36.3, indicating significant blood sugar impact. Contains 20.0g carbs, 13.0g sugar, 1.0g fiber, 3.0g protein per serving. Likely to cause noticeable blood sugar increase. Consider portion size and individual response when planning meals.
Key Nutrients
Per 35.0g servingPeanut butter crispy bar, peanut butter contains 20.0g of carbs, 13.0g of sugar, 3.0g of protein, 6.0g of fat, and 1.0g of fiber per 35.0g serving. These nutrients directly impact blood sugar levels and overall nutritional value.

INGREDIENTS:
PEANUT BUTTER (PEANUTS, DEXTROSE, FULLY HYDROGENATED VEGETABLE OILS [COTTONSEED, SOYBEAN, RAPESEED), SALT), INVERT SUGAR, CRISP RICE (RICE, SUGAR, CORN SYRUP, SALT, THIAMINE MONONITRATE, RIBOFLAVIN, NIACINAMIDE, PYRIDOXINE HYDROCHLORIDE, FOLIC ACID, VITAMIN B12, VITAMIN A PALMITATE, SODIUM ASCORBATE, VITAMIN D3, FERRIC ORTHOPHOSPHATE, ZINC OXIDE), CORN SYRUP, FROSTING (SUGAR, HYDROGENATED PALM KERNEL OIL, COCOA POWDER, CHOCOLATE LIQUOR, COCOA POWDER PROCESSED WITH ALKALI, WHEY POWDER [MILK), SOY LECITHIN (EMULSIFIER), SALT, ARTIFICIAL FLAVOR), SUGAR.
